Well, these apps can be really helpful for aspiring writers in multiple ways. Firstly, they provide a private space to write. For instance, apps like iA Writer have a minimalist design that helps you focus solely on your story. Secondly, many of these apps have features like spell check and grammar correction, which can enhance the quality of your writing. And thirdly, the community aspect in apps like Wattpad. Here, you can interact with other writers, learn from them, and even get your work noticed, which can boost your confidence as an aspiring writer.

Well, for aspiring writers, 'The Art of Fiction' by John Gardner is like a guidebook. It helps them understand the nuances of different narrative techniques. For example, they can learn how to use flashbacks or foreshadowing effectively. It also teaches about the significance of creating a consistent tone throughout the story. Additionally, by studying the book, they can gain an understanding of how to handle different genres, as the principles in the book can be applied across various types of fiction writing.
